titleOfInvention | Process for the preparation of aromatic copolyesters |
abstract | A process is disclosed for the production of alkylaromatic copolyesters, characterized in that there are reacted, successively, at a temperature below 250 DEG C., a diester of a dihydroxyaromatic compound and an aliphatid diacid of the general formula HOOC(CH2)nCOOH, in which 3</=n</=10, with a molar ratio of the diester to the diacid of between 1.5 and 4, until the degree of completion of the reaction is greater than or equal to 85%, and them, at a temperature above 250 DEG C., an aromatic and/or cycloaliphatic dicarboxylic acid, and in that the product obtained is subjected to a polycondensation reaction under reduced pressure for a duration which is less than or equal to 1 hour 30 minutes. This process makes it possible to produce copolyesters which may be readily converted in the molten state to threads, films and molded articles. |
